How Avalanche Works
Avalanche’s architecture splits functionality across three blockchains:
| Chain | Purpose |
|-------------|----------------------------------|
| X-Chain | Asset creation and exchange. |
| C-Chain | Smart contracts (EVM-compatible).|
| P-Chain | Validator coordination & subnets.|
Validators stake 2,000+ AVAX to secure the network, earning rewards while maintaining decentralization.

FAQs
1. What is AVAX used for?
AVAX powers transactions, staking, and governance within Avalanche’s ecosystem.
2. How does Avalanche achieve fast transactions?
Its Avalanche consensus randomly samples validators to confirm transactions in seconds.
3. Is Avalanche better than Ethereum?
Avalanche offers faster speeds and lower fees but leverages Ethereum’s tooling for compatibility.
4. How do I stake AVAX?
Stake via Avalanche Wallet or supported exchanges with a minimum of 2,000 AVAX.
5. What’s the total supply of AVAX?
720 million AVAX, with 407 million currently circulating.
